The Temple is a 2017 horror film directed by Scott Spiegel (director of Hostel Part IIIIntruder; co-writer of Evil Dead II) from a screenplay by Peter Alan Roberts. It stars Ian Buchanan, Keith Jefferson, Charlotte Ellen Price, Andy Summers (former guitarist with rock band The Police) and Kinley Pelden. 

A hardened policewoman is sent to investigate a temple robbery in the remote Himalayas where she is confronted by wary villagers and snooping American TV crew. Horrific murders mount, flaring rumors of the fearsome guardian goddess demanding return of the stolen precious DZI beads…

Principal photography on the film began on 20 January 2016 in Bhutan, being produced by Happy Himalayan Pictures and Dream It Productions
